The Difference Between Glass And Frame Damage
Glass breaks happen for many reasons. A stray baseball or a fallen branch can shatter a perfectly good window. If the wooden or vinyl frame looks new, you can simply swap the glass. This path saves money and time. You keep the original look of your home while fixing the immediate safety hazard.
Frame failure is a much bigger problem. Wood eventually softens and decays due to rain. Vinyl can warp or crack after years of sun exposure. A damaged frame cannot hold a new piece of glass securely. Air leaks around the edges even if the glass is perfect. You will spend more on heating bills than the cost of a proper installation.
When Is A Simple Glass Repair Enough?
Small chips often stay small for a long time. You can sometimes resin-fill a minor crack to prevent it from spreading. This works best on single-pane windows in garages or sheds. Most modern homes use insulated glass units with two or three layers.
Repairing one layer of a multi-pane window is almost impossible. The factory seals these units with special gases like argon. Breaking the seal lets the gas out and moisture in. You lose all the insulating value of the window immediately. Professionals usually replace the entire "IGU" or insulated glass unit rather than just one side.
Can Rotting Frames Be Saved?
Soft spots in a windowsill signal deep trouble. You can poke the wood with a screwdriver to check for firmness. Crumbling wood means water has reached the interior of your wall. Paint often hides this damage until the problem becomes severe.
Patching rot with putty only provides a temporary mask. The fungus continues to eat the wood underneath the patch. Eventually, the entire window might sag or fall out of alignment. Why Do Foggy Windows Require Total Replacement?
Condensation inside the glass looks like a permanent mist. This happens when the seal around the edges fails. You cannot wipe this moisture away because it sits between the panes. It blocks your view and makes your home look neglected.
Foggy glass means your window no longer provides a thermal barrier. Your furnace works harder to fight the cold air seeping through the failed seal. Replacing just the glass panels is an option here. However, many homeowners find that the cost of labor for glass repair nearly matches the price of a brand-new window. New windows come with better warranties and updated technology.
Signs You Need A Completely New Window
-
Operational Failure: The window sticks or requires a prop to stay open.
-
Severe Drafts: You feel a breeze even when the window is locked.
-
Water Leaks: Puddles appear on the floor after a heavy rainstorm.
-
Excessive Noise: You hear every car and conversation from the street.
-
Visible Gaps: You see daylight between the sash and the frame.

Sound Dampening Benefits
Living near a busy road makes a quiet home feel like a luxury. Thick frames and triple-pane glass block a significant amount of street noise. You will notice the silence as soon as the installers finish the job. This improvement makes your home a much more relaxing place to live.
Standard glass repair does not usually improve soundproofing. The frames often cause the most noise leakage. A full replacement seals the entire opening against sound waves. You can finally sleep through the night without hearing the neighbors' dogs or early morning traffic.
